Snakes on the Trail: What Australian Mountain Bikers Need to Know
Most riders go years without an incident. Some go decades. And then one spring morning you come around a blind corner at pace and there's a metre and a half of Eastern Brown draped across the trail like a garden hose.
Snakes on MTB trails in Australia aren't a rare occurrence — they're a seasonal reality. The window from October through to late March is when Australia's venomous species are most active, which maps almost perfectly onto peak riding months in the south and year-round in the north. Knowing what to expect, how to read a snake's behaviour, and what to do if someone is bitten is the kind of thing worth settling before you need it.

Which snakes will you actually encounter on Australian trails?
Australia has more venomous terrestrial snakes than any other country. The species you'll cross paths with depends heavily on your riding location.
| Species | Where you'll encounter them | Typical habitat | Danger if bitten |
|---|---|---|---|
| Eastern Brown | NSW, VIC, QLD, SA, WA | Open dry woodland, paddock edges, fire roads | Extremely high — Australia's most lethal species |
| Tiger Snake | VIC, SA, TAS, southern WA, south NSW coast | Creek crossings, wetland edges, alpine zones | Extremely high |
| Red-Bellied Black | QLD, NSW, VIC | Near dams and creeks, wet sclerophyll forest | High (less lethal than brown/tiger, but painful) |
| Highland Copperhead | Alpine VIC, ACT, TAS | Sub-alpine zones above ~1,000 m | High |
| Death Adder | NSW Central Coast, QLD, NT, WA | Leaf litter, heath, dense ground cover | Extremely high |
| Dugite | WA (Perth hills, coastal areas) | Sandy heath, banksia scrub | Very high |
The Eastern Brown is the one riders see most often. It moves fast, tends to be on open ground and fire roads, and it's the species responsible for more fatalities per year in Australia than any other. It's also more assertive than most — when crowded, it can rear and spread a hood before striking. If you see that display, you've already come too close. Back up slowly.
Tiger snakes are heavy and slow by comparison, which means they're often still there when you roll up on them. They dominate wherever there's water: creek crossings throughout Victoria and Tasmania, the Otways, the Grampians. In alpine zones above about 1,200 m — Mt Buller, Falls Creek, Kosciuszko, the ACT highlands — the Highland Copperhead is the main species. They come out later in the day as the air warms up, so early laps at altitude are lower risk.
When are snakes active on Australian MTB trails?
October to March covers the main active window for most of Australia. The ACT Government records the season formally as October to March. CSIRO research published in 2024 noted that warm winters are pushing activity earlier — some years southern snakes are appearing on trails in mid-September when historically they'd still be dormant.
By species and timing:
- Eastern Brown: most active through spring (October–November mating season), then feeding hard December–February
- Tiger Snake: active through the warm months; mating peaks December into January
- Highland Copperhead: later to warm up — in alpine zones expect peak activity from November onwards, not October
- Death Adder: active from October; in Queensland and the Northern Territory, effectively year-round
Time of day matters as much as time of year. Snakes thermoregulate by moving between sun and shade. Early morning is high-risk — they come out to bask and warm up. Late afternoon too. On a 35-degree midday, they're usually sheltering under rocks and logs and out of your way. On mild overcast days they can be active for most of the day.
Treat September as the start of snake season, not October. The northern half of Australia is already warm by then, and in a mild autumn year, riders in NSW and VIC are already calling it on social channels by late September.
What to do when you see a snake on the trail
Nine times out of ten, it moves before you get close. Snakes detect ground vibration and take off long before you round the corner. The times you actually see one are usually when it's basking on something warm — a flat rock, the timbers of a bridge, a stretch of open trail in full sun — and didn't register your approach.
Slow down or stop. Don't try to swerve over it. A moving bike is an unpredictable threat, and the snake will react.
Give it space. Most snakes given 3–4 metres of clearance will move off on their own. Stand still or move back slowly. No sudden movements.
Wait it out. If it's not leaving, give it a minute. If you need to pass, go around with maximum clearance — off the trail edge if needed. Do not crowd it.
Tell the riders behind you. Spin around or yell. The last thing anyone needs is the next rider coming in hot around the same corner two minutes later.
Don't touch it. Don't prod it with your bike, your pump, your helmet or anything else. A significant proportion of bites in Australia happen because someone tried to handle or move a snake. If it looks dead on the trail, still don't touch it — reflex bites from recently-killed snakes are documented.
Snake bite first aid on the trail: the step-by-step
This is the one you need to know before you need it. Australia's pressure-immobilisation protocol, developed by Professor Struan Sutherland at CSL in the 1970s, is recommended by St John Australia and ANZCOR for all land snake bites. It works because Australian snake venom travels via the lymphatic system, not the bloodstream — pressure and immobilisation slow that movement dramatically.
1. Stop immediately and get the bitten person off their bike. Sitting or lying down, not moving.
2. Keep them still and calm. Panic raises heart rate. A higher heart rate speeds lymphatic circulation. The goal is to keep both as low as possible.
3. Apply a compression bandage firmly over the bite site. Use a broad elasticised bandage — 10–15 cm wide. Start at the bite and wrap over it. Pressure should be firm enough that you can't easily slide a finger under the bandage, but not so tight it cuts off circulation. Think "strapping a sprained ankle", not a tourniquet.
4. Apply a second bandage from the furthest point upward. If the bite is on the lower leg, start from the toes and wrap up the leg as high as the bandage reaches. This slows the movement of venom up through the lymph vessels toward the core.
5. Immobilise the limb with a splint. Use whatever's available — a stick, a pump, a frame tube. Strap it in place. The limb should not bend or move.
6. Call 000. Do this as soon as the bandage is on — ideally while a second rider handles the bandaging. Tell the operator where you are: trail name, park name, nearest trailhead, and GPS coordinates if you have them. Every Australian park with a significant visitor count has emergency coordinates on Trailforks and AllTrails.
7. Note the time and mark the bite site. Write on the bandage or on the skin with a marker: the time the bite occurred, and an arrow indicating the location under the bandage. Hospital staff need this.
8. Do not remove the bandage. The bandage is trapping venom near the bite site. Removing it releases it into the system at once. The hospital cuts it off in a controlled environment after antivenin is ready.
9. Do not let the bitten person ride for help. Send a second rider if you have one. The bitten person stays put and stays still. Riding out is how people die — physical exertion is the fastest way to accelerate venom absorption.
What NOT to do
These are common instincts that make things worse:
- Do not cut the bite or try to suck out venom. It does nothing useful and risks infection.
- Do not apply a tourniquet. Concentrating venom in a limb damages tissue and makes outcomes worse.
- Do not wash the bite site. Hospital staff swab the skin around the bite to identify the specific venom type. Washing destroys that sample and can delay the correct antivenin by hours.
- Do not apply ice or cold packs. No evidence of benefit; risk of cold injury.
- Do not try to catch or identify the snake. Australia has a polyvalent snake antivenin that covers most of the major species. Sending someone back to find the snake is a reliable way to get a second bite victim. The swab from the bite site does the identification.
- Do not give alcohol or pain medication before hospital. Alcohol dilates blood vessels; aspirin thins blood. Neither helps.
What to carry in snake season
From September to April, these go in the pack on every ride:
Two elasticised compression bandages, 10–15 cm wide. One for the bite site, one for the limb. Purpose-made snake bite bandages (longer, with a tension indicator printed on them) are better than generic crepe. Anaconda, BCF, and any pharmacy stock them for a few dollars. They weigh under 100 g and take up less space than a spare tube.
A marker pen. Small enough to tuck into a pack pocket. Used to write the time and mark the bite location on the bandage after a bite.
A charged phone with GPS enabled. Before heading out on remote trails, download the offline map in Trailforks or AllTrails. If you're in a coverage black spot, a Garmin inReach satellite communicator means 000 is reachable even when your phone isn't.
Riding with at least one other person. The bite response above assumes a second rider applies the bandage and makes the call while the bitten person stays still. Solo riding in remote trails is a risk calculation that shifts significantly in snake season. If you do ride solo, tell someone your route and expected return time.
FAQ
Are snakes dangerous on mountain bike trails in Australia?
Venomous species — Eastern Brown, Tiger Snake, Red-Bellied Black, Death Adder — are present on Australian trails and encounters are common, but actual bites are rare. Australia records around 3,000 snakebite envenomations per year across the entire country, with roughly two fatalities annually. That figure reflects the effectiveness of pressure-immobilisation first aid and rapid access to antivenin, not any leniency in the snakes themselves.
What do I do if I'm bitten mountain biking in Australia?
Stop immediately and do not ride. Sit or lie down. Apply a compression bandage firmly over the bite site, then apply a second bandage from the furthest point of the limb upward and splint the whole limb so it can't move. Call 000. The bitten rider must stay as still as possible — movement is how venom spreads. Send a second rider for help if needed; the bitten person stays put.
Which snakes are most common on MTB trails?
The Eastern Brown is the most frequently seen on trails across NSW, VIC, QLD, SA, and WA — fast, found on open ground, and extremely venomous. Tiger snakes dominate near waterways and across Tasmania. In alpine zones above 1,000 m the Highland Copperhead is the main species. The distribution varies enough by region that it's worth knowing the local species before a ride.
When does snake season start in Australia?
October to March is the standard active window in the southern states. In Queensland and the Northern Territory, snakes are active year-round. In alpine zones, activity typically peaks from November onwards. CSIRO research from 2024 found warm winters are pushing activity earlier, so treat September as the practical start of snake season rather than October.
Do I need to carry a snake bite kit?
Two broad elasticised compression bandages, 10–15 cm wide, is the core of the kit. Commercial "snake bite kits" that include lancets, suction cups, or tourniquets are outdated — the current Australian standard, per St John and ANZCOR, is pressure-immobilisation only. A kit with a lancet in it tells you it was written before the 1980s.
Does riding fast protect you from snakes?
Partly. Snakes feel ground vibration and often move off trail before you arrive — higher speed reduces your window of exposure on any given stretch. The trade-off is reaction time: at 30 km/h you have under a second to respond to a snake on the trail once you see it. This is more an argument for riding with awareness on blind corners than for riding fast everywhere.
